Output ebffcaf31cfb76b3cbdee081e6af2fd3a8f1f72eaa5bcdb3f234871de7aafd46:1

value
2204972810
script pubkey
OP_0 OP_PUSHBYTES_20 850f5b8056ebbf203f28ebe65a859bfeda252c64
address
bc1qs584hqzkawljq0ega0n94pvmlmdz2trymx4wpm
transaction
ebffcaf31cfb76b3cbdee081e6af2fd3a8f1f72eaa5bcdb3f234871de7aafd46